The Kansas City Royals beat the Detroit Tigers 10-3 on Tuesday, May 21. Kansas City scored the first eight runs of the game, knocking Tigers starter Casey Mize out of the game in the second inning. Bobby Witt Jr. homered twice and drove in six runs in the game. Hunter Renfroe also
had a solo homer. Alec Marsh went six innings, allowing three runs on five hits. The Royals are now 31-19 on the season and have won five in a row.
